About Box Hill 3128

The size of Box Hill is approximately 3.5 square kilometres. It has 18 parks covering nearly 14.2% of total area. The population of Box Hill in 2011 was 9,671 people. By 2016 the population was 11,416 showing a population growth of 18.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Box Hill is 20-29 years. Households in Box Hill are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Box Hill work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 46.5% of the homes in Box Hill were owner-occupied compared with 39.4% in 2016.

Box Hill has 11,587 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Box Hill have seen a 16.15% increase in median value, while Units have seen a -1.72% decrease. As at 31 August 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Box Hill is $1,620,569 while the median value for Units is $470,963.
  • Houses have a median rent of $590 while Units have a median rent of $550.
